Key Patch Highlights and Community Response
Dragon’s Dogma 2’s latest update delivers substantial quality-of-life improvements that directly address player feedback since launch. This comprehensive patch introduces features that fundamentally enhance the gameplay experience for both new and returning adventurers.
The most significant addition allows players to initiate fresh playthroughs without manual save file management, resolving one of the community’s primary frustrations
Since its recent release, Dragon’s Dogma 2 has received widespread acclaim for its immersive world design and dynamic combat systems. However, several design choices generated considerable discussion within the player community. The inability to easily restart the game or modify character appearance without significant resource investment emerged as consistent pain points for players exploring different build possibilities.
Capcom has responded with remarkable speed to these community concerns. The current update is immediately available on PC and PlayStation 5 platforms, with Xbox Series X|S compatibility scheduled within days. Beyond the much-requested new game functionality, developers have dramatically increased Art of Metamorphosis availability to 99 units per vendor, eliminating previous restrictions on character redesign experimentation.
Additionally, progression pacing receives thoughtful adjustment through earlier access to personal dwelling acquisition quests. This strategic modification allows players to establish reliable save points and resting locations sooner in their adventure, significantly reducing backtracking during critical early-game exploration phases.

Strategic Implementation Guide
Maximize your Dragon’s Dogma 2 experience with these practical implementation strategies following the latest update:
Optimization Priority: If experiencing performance issues, begin by disabling Ray Tracing followed by Motion Blur. The 30fps cap provides most significant stability improvement for struggling systems. DLSS Quality mode typically offers best balance between performance and visual fidelity on supported hardware.
Character Strategy: Utilize the abundant Art of Metamorphosis items to experiment with different character builds without commitment anxiety. Consider creating specialized appearances for specific vocations to enhance roleplaying immersion. Early dwelling acquisition enables more aggressive exploration since safe resting locations become accessible sooner.
Common Pitfalls: Avoid overlooking the dwelling quest amidst early-game excitement – completing it immediately provides substantial quality-of-life benefits. Don’t assume graphical toggles will dramatically improve performance; significant framerate optimization awaits future patches. Remember that Xbox players should anticipate slight delay before receiving these updates.
